The Union for Reform Judaism, already boasting an extensive web site at www.urj.org, has added a new blog (Web Log). According to a spokeperson:
This week the Union launched a new blog — RJ.org: News and Views of Reform Jews that will, we hope, become a free marketplace of ideas about Judaism and the role it plays in our lives. The blog is a platform for Reform Jews and those who care about Judaism to come together to kibbitz and learn in an online community.
I haven’t had time to take more than a quick look, but the blog will apparently apparently accept submissions from readers as well as comments on published material. It also seems to be an easy way to gain access to information published on the many other sites maintained by the Union and its many affiliates. This should be a welcome addition to the Jewish blogging community.
